Wayne Jensen wrote on 4/24/07 7:24 PM: > Every once in a while for no apparent reason, Asterisk has been dying > on me, dropping all calls in progress. There's nothing in the log > file or on the Asterisk console that indicates the reason. Some days > it doesn't happen at all. Other days it happens two or three times. > > The problem began on Friday, but the last time anything was changed on > that box was at least a week before that. > > Any suggestions on what to do/where to look to find out what's going > on and fix the problem?
There was a security update for Asterisk released yesterday which addresses a denial-of-service class vulnerability in which malformed SIP packets could cause asterisk to crash. Our server also randomly died once on Monday morning with no apparent cause. It's possible someone was exploiting this.
